A parallel-plate capacitor has a voltage V = 6.0 V between its plates. Each plate carries a surface charge density σ = 7.0 nC/m2. What is the separation of the plates?


A) 8.2 mm
B) 2.5 mm
C) 1.2 mm
D) 5.6 mm
E) 7.6 mm
